从零开始学习计算机科学
计算机科学作为一门新兴的学科,已经在当今社会中扮演着极其重要的角。随着科技的发展和普及,对于计算机科学的学习需求也越来越大。然而,对于许多没有任何编程基础的人来说,学习计算机科学可能是一项具有挑战性的任务。本文将探讨如何从零开始学习计算机科学,希望可以为初学者提供一些指导和启发。
首先,了解计算机的基本原理是非常重要的。要想学习计算机科学,我们首先需要知道计算机是如何工作的。计算机是一种能够执行指令的机器,其工作原理基于一系列的电子和物理原理。学习计算机科学的第一步可以是了解计算机的基本结构和运行原理。通过学习计算机的内部组成和工作方式,我们可以更好地理解计算机科学的相关概念和理论。
其次,学习编程语言是必不可少的。编程语言是计算机与人类进行交流的工具,也是学习计算机科学的基础。目前,市面上存在着众多的编程语言,如Python、C++、Java等。对于初学者来说,选择一门易学且功能强大的编程语言是很重要的。Python是一门广泛应用于科学计算和数据分析的编程语言,也是很多计算机科学入门教材的首选语言。学习Python不仅可以培养编程思维,还可以为后续学习其他编程语言打下坚实的基础。
零基础学java编程
除了学习编程语言,了解算法和数据结构也是非常重要的。算法可以看作是解决问题的一种方法,而数据结构则是存储和组织数据的方式。算法和数据结构是计算机科学中的核心基础,对于编写高效的程序至关重要。学习算法和数据结构可以让我们更好地理解计算机科学中的各种问题和解决方法。掌握常见的排序算法、搜索算法、树结构等数据结构,可以提高我们的编程能力和解决问题的能力。
此外,进行实践和实验也是学习计算机科学不可或缺的一部分。理论知识固然重要,但只有通过实践才能更好地理解和应用所学知识。编写小程序、解决实际问题、参与开源项目等实践活动可以帮助我们将理论和实际结合起来,提高编程技能和解决问题的能力。通过实践,我们可以不断地发现问题、解决问题,并积累经验和知识。
最后,保持学习的态度和兴趣是学习计算机科学的关键。学习计算机科学是一项长期的、持续的过程。在学习的过程中,我们可能会遇到各种困难和挫折。然而,只要我们保持对计算机科学的兴趣和热情,相信自己的能力,并坚持不懈地学习和实践,我们就能够逐渐提高自己的技能和水平,成为一名合格的计算机科学家。
总之,从零开始学习计算机科学可能是一项具有挑战性的任务,但只要我们掌握正确的学
习方法和态度,就能够克服困难,取得成功。通过了解计算机的基本原理、学习编程语言、掌握算法和数据结构、进行实践和保持学习的态度和兴趣,我们可以逐步提高自己的编程能力和解决问题的能力,走上学习计算机科学的道路。希望这些指导和启发对于初学者能够有所帮助,让我们一起迈出学习计算机科学的第一步。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。